Callisia 'Turtle'
Am I easy to maintain?
Yes, the plant is easy to care for and has few requirements. It only needs moderate water and indirect sunlight, and thrives well in normal room temperatures. Regularly pruning the plant will help to control its growth.
Do I need a lot of light?
Yes, the plant needs a lot of light to grow well. Therefore, it is best to place it in a location with plenty of indirect sunlight. Make sure it doesn't receive too much direct sunlight to prevent sunburn.
How many times a week do I need watering?
The plant needs water on average once a week. Make sure the soil remains lightly moist between waterings. The plant can do with less water in the winter.
Do I like the bright sun or not?
The Callisia 'Turtle' does not like direct sunlight and is best placed in an area with indirect light. Too much bright sun can damage the leaves. It is therefore advisable to protect the plant from excessive sunlight.
Do I like warmth?
Yes, Callisia 'Turtle' loves warmth. This plant thrives best at a constant indoor temperature between 18 and 24 degrees Celsius. Place the plant in a warm and bright spot in the house for optimal growth.
In which months do I bloom and for how long?
This plant usually blooms in the months of April and May. The flowering period typically lasts about 3-4 weeks.
